Output 568b3aac47e1147a58ffd4c101ab344562aed278b8d25333a56bb25786476bfa:21

value
2773968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26bf1062d77c5761fc70e8e77c151e2c4b3f9470 OP_EQUAL
address
35DtVCAdAA1RDacpDc6P2L1SQFYVqUAEdJ
transaction
568b3aac47e1147a58ffd4c101ab344562aed278b8d25333a56bb25786476bfa
spent
true